David Cort

David Cort was a founding member of the New York based Videofreex, a pioneering collective of media activists formed in 1969 to explore communication processes. The countercultural collective's work was grounded in the conviction that access to portable video equipment could provide an alternative voice to the monolith of network television.   full biography
